Material: The Brilliance of 24% Lead Crystal
Many pieces within the Shannon Crystal collection are crafted from 24% lead crystal. This specific composition is crucial to achieving crystal’s desirable characteristics: exceptional clarity, impressive sparkle, and a satisfying weight in hand. The lead content enhances the crystal’s ability to refract light, creating a dazzling display often referred to as “fire” and “brilliance.” This makes each glass shimmer under varying light conditions, elevating the visual appeal of any beverage. While some pieces may be made of unleaded crystal, those with 24% lead crystal typically offer a superior heft and optical quality.
The Signature Dublin Pattern: Timeless Elegance
Among the most celebrated designs in the Shannon Crystal range is the iconic Dublin pattern. This classic cut crystal design features a distinctive combination of starbursts and checker patterns that catch and reflect light beautifully. The Dublin pattern has a timeless, upscale aesthetic that seamlessly blends with both traditional and contemporary decor. Its enduring popularity is a testament to its elegant simplicity and its ability to instantly elevate a table setting or bar collection, making it a versatile choice for any home.

Durability and Care: Practicality in Use
For many, the perceived fragility of crystal is a deterrent. However, Godinger Shannon Crystal is often highlighted for its robust feel. While traditionally, lead crystal is hand-washed, some modern pieces within the Shannon collection, particularly everyday tumblers, are designed to be dishwasher safe. Always check specific product care instructions, but this practicality is a major advantage for busy households who want crystal without the extra hassle. For more delicate or intricate pieces, gentle hand-washing is still recommended to preserve their luster and integrity over time.

Comparing Godinger Shannon Crystal in the Market
When considering “affordable luxury,” it’s helpful to understand where Godinger Shannon Crystal stands relative to other brands. While it doesn’t aim to compete directly with ultra-premium European crystal houses like Baccarat or St. Louis in terms of handcrafted artistry or lead content, it skillfully carves out its niche by offering comparable aesthetic appeal and a substantial feel at a significantly lower price.
Many find Godinger Shannon Crystal to be an excellent entry point into the world of crystal glassware, often viewed as an “affordable line” similar to Waterford’s Marquis collection. For those looking to expand their collection, some users have noted that the Dublin pattern closely matches other accessible crystal lines, such as the RCR Crystalaria Melodia brand from Italy, offering options for complementary stemware like wine chalices and champagne flutes. This makes it easier to build a cohesive and elegant table setting without solely relying on one brand.
